β¦ Synopsis
Fear wears many skins.
Deep within the Canadian wilderness, people have been disappearing for over a century. There is a place the locals call "the Devil's Woods", but to speak of it will only bring the devil to your door. It is a place so evil that even animals avoid it.
When their father's expedition team goes missing, Kyle Elkheart and his brother and sister return to the abandoned Cree Indian reservation where they were born. Kyle can see ghosts that haunt the woods surrounding the village--and they seem to be trying to warn him. The search for their father will lead Kyle and his siblings to the dark heart of the legendary forest, where their mission will quickly become a fight for survival.
